Having built a devout following in Las Vegas and the Western US, Heers unleashes his images and characters onto his debut Nashville studio record featuring 12 self-penned songs brought to life by an all-star cast.
Led by bandleader Pat McGrath (Jim Lauderdale, Alison Krauss), Western Stars kicks off with a giant song; "Dirt Rich", a two-stepper about a "wealthy" farmer, and then shifts into a breathtaking journey through country, Americana and folk, including the much talked about “Sarah The Butterfly”.
A native Las Vegan, Heers learned to craft songs while living in Nashville and is on the leading edge of the booming Las Vegas country music scene. Heers draws influence from a long list of songwriting masters including Guy Clark, Steve Earle and Don Schlitz. Vocally, his style is a blend of Don McLean, Garth Brooks, and George Strait.
Western Stars features Dow Tomlin Jr. (Brooks & Dunn) on bass, Mike Rojas (Patty Loveless, Blake Shelton) on keyboards, Drummer Wayne Killius (Big & Rich, Blackhawk), Lead Guitar Mike Durham (Tim McGraw) and Mike Daley (Hank Williams Jr.) on Steel Guitar.
Special guests include Steve Hinson (Kenny Chesney, Willie Nelson) on Steel Guitar, Deannie Richardson (Vince Gill) on Fiddle and Tammy Pierce (Kenny Rogers, Kenny Chesney) on background vocals.
Western Stars was mastered for radio by Hank Williams at MasterMix Nashville.
